pub fn generate_address(
parent_key: PublicKey,
emulated_merkle_root: TapNodeHash,
backup_merkle_root: Option<TapNodeHash>,
network: Network,
) -> Result<Address, Error>Expand description
Generates P2TR address from a parent public key and the emulated merkle root, with an optional backup merkle root.
§Arguments
parent_key- The parent public keyemulated_merkle_root- The merkle root of the emulated inputbackup_merkle_root- Optional merkle root for backup script path spendingnetwork- The network to generate the address for
§Errors
Returns an error if key derivation fails